EPA-SNEP says Goodbye and Good Luck to ORISE Fellow, Shasten Sherwell.

 

For over two years, Shasten Sherwell has worked as a microbial ecologist, marine biologist, and dedicated team member with the Southeast New England Program.

 

During her time as an ORISE Fellow stationed at EPA, Shasten was integral in researching harmful algal blooms throughout the SNEP region.

 

As part of this effort, Shasten worked to design and facilitate the HABs Risk Communication webinar last year, which produced a preliminary list of key HAB questions that state and municipal partners receive most often.

 

A completed HAB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) will be developed from this work in 2023 and posted to the SNEP website.

 

Additionally, Shasten has spearheaded a SNEP-specific HAB monitoring program in key areas of the SNEP region including New Bedford, MA; Fall River, MA; and Woonsocket, RI. SNEP plans to continue this monitoring effort in Shasten’s absence.
